For the majority of bankrupts, the procedure goes rather smoothly and also they are released at the end of 3 years and 1 day. Yet there are offences connected with insolvency for which debtors may be prosecuted. The majority of offences connect to deceit or failure to tell the trustee concerning income or property. There is likewise an offense pertaining to betting or harmful speculation, and one more for sustaining credit report which it was clear you can not pay.


If you are worried regarding any one of these concerns, talk with your financial counsellor or get legal guidance. Once you're decreed insolvent, financial institutions can not remain to chase you for any debt included in your insolvency. On discharge from your insolvency, you are released from a lot of the financial obligations consisted of in your insolvency and also you do not need to pay anymore of the impressive quantity owed to the lenders consisted of in your insolvency.

Secured financial debt is omitted from insolvencies because the creditor can retrieve the building if you don't pay, and market it to get their refund. If there's still cash owing after they've repossessed and also offered the residential or commercial property, that quantity ends up being an unsecured financial obligation and is after that included in the personal bankruptcy.
